Premier Project Coordination Systems for Flexible Teams
Navigating the evolving world of Scrum development demands the right workflow organization platforms. Several excellent options exist to facilitate workforce collaboration and produce exceptional results. Consider Jira, a widely-used tool known for its powerful capabilities, particularly suited for product development. Trello, with its visual board approach, is perfect for smaller teams and tasks. Asana offers a balance of functionality, permitting teams to handle both Scrum click here and waterfall workflows. Finally, Monday.com provides a flexible workspace created to track progress. Choosing the best system relies on your team's specific needs and approach.
